A bird has fluke worms in its intestines, and they feed on the bird’s tissues and infect them. What is this an example of?

a.) parasitism

b.) defensive mutualism

c.) commensalism

d.) dispersive mutualism

Parasitism.

In parasitism, one organism benefits from the relationship, but at the expense of another. When the bird has fluke worms in its intestines, the fluke worm is able to feed on the bird’s tissues, which benefits the fluke worm. However, this can infect the bird, causing it harm.
